“AS IT SHOULD” — BTS’ j-hope’s Mona Lisa Debuts at #1 on This Week’s Digital Song Sales Chart, Fans Celebrate

BTS’ j-hope has achieved a remarkable milestone with his newest single, Mona Lisa, which has surged to the top of the Digital Song Sales chart. This notable accomplishment was announced on social media platform X by account @chartdata on March 31, 2025. Since its release on March 21, this track has rapidly gained popularity, firmly establishing itself at the forefront of digital sales.

The Artistic Inspiration Behind Mona Lisa

Prior to its official debut, j-hope presented Mona Lisa during his concert, HOPE ON THE STAGE, at the Barclays Center in Brooklyn. In a heartfelt moment, he conveyed that the song reflects his love for ARMY, the dedicated fanbase.

The track showcases contributions from notable producers including Blake Slatkin, Cashmere Cat, and Misogi. With a music video released on the same day, Mona Lisa draws inspiration from Leonardo da Vinci’s celebrated artwork, while communicating a profound message that transcends mere visual allure.

BIGHIT Music has elaborated that the song emphasizes intrinsic beauty, celebrating the unique qualities that make individuals special rather than solely relying on external appearances. This makes the track a genuine tribute to beauty in all its forms.

Mona Lisa Makes Waves in Music Charts

On April 1, 2025, Mona Lisa entered the Billboard Hot 100 at position 65. Its success also extended to other prestigious charts: the song reached No. 14 on the Billboard Global 200 and secured the top position on the Digital Song Sales Chart. Notably, this achievement marks j-hope’s second No. 1 single of the year, following the success of Sweet Dreams featuring Miguel.

In addition to the Billboard achievements, Mona Lisa made impressive strides in various international charts, including No. 69 on the Canadian Hot 100, No. 9 on Japan’s Digital Singles chart, and No. 8 on both Japan’s Download Songs chart and New Zealand’s Hot Singles chart. Furthermore, it ranked No. 22 in Singapore’s RIAS chart, No. 84 on South Korea’s Circle chart, and No. 56 on the UK Singles chart.

In March 2025, j-hope also released Sweet Dreams, a collaboration with Grammy-winner Miguel, further showcasing his versatility as an artist.

HOPE ON THE STAGE: j-hope’s Triumphant Return

After completing his military service, j-hope has made a triumphant return to the spotlight with his solo world tour, HOPE ON THE STAGE. This extensive tour commenced with a three-night concert series at Seoul’s KSPO Dome, starting on February 28, 2025.

Following the kickoff in Seoul, j-hope is set to perform across major North American venues, including the Barclays Center in New York, Allstate Arena in Chicago, and BMO Stadium in Los Angeles. His tour will then continue into Asia with scheduled performances in Manila on April 12 and 13, Saitama on April 19 and 20, Singapore on April 26 and 27, and Jakarta on May 3 and 4.

Further shows are lined up in Bangkok on May 10 and 11, Macau on May 17 and 18, and Taipei on May 24 and 25, culminating in a grand finale performance in Osaka on June 1.
